The client services specialist fulfills essential tasks related to delivering service to a client. Client Services specialists act as first-line representatives and subject matter experts responsible for handling client inquiries to ensure satisfactory resolution to issues that may arise. He/she will handle escalated calls, process extraordinary transactions, as well as develop and lead staff training on client specific requirements, etc. Specialists are responsible for order processing, order auditing, and communication and resolution of issues that may prevent orders from shipping. Under general supervision, processes customer requests related to orders in a timely, accurate and professional manner. Fosters the growth of a strong client base through creating positive interactions and building strong relationships.
